I have several reasons I like wrecking yards besides the good prices.

If you can pull the part yourself you can see how the assembly goes together. It's like experimenting on someone else's car rather than your own. I've discovered several "gotcha points" that would have messed me up on my own vehicle had I not had the opportunity to pull apart the assembly on the donor car. It's like a practice session for the real deal.

You can usually take with you any various fasteners, clips, nuts etc. that come off the car as you pull the part. The yards don't want these and don't charge you for it. Now you have spares as you work on your car. If you end up not needing them just toss them when you are done. I hate is when your are "one clip short" of finishing the job because you broke or lost a small item.

I was told aftermarket mirror can have problem with shaking. Does any of the mirror you got shakes?
I have never had any issues with aftermarket mirrors, but I could just be lucky. The ones I usually buy are the $40 ones on ebay so I think it's a good value vs $250 for an OEM, but it's all preference. All mirrors I have gotten were powered as well. No quality issues experienced.

You could even replace both mirrors to match the color if you choose to not have them painted lol. Nothing wrong with black mirrors in my opinion
Whatever you do, don't pay anyone more than $50 to install mirrors. It takes no more than a half hour to install mirrors and that's for someone who hasn't done it before.
